Google Workspace Advantages

1. Identity Management

Workers today use a variety of different methods, such as WhatsApp, Slack, message boards, emails, conference calls, and weekly meetings, to keep in touch and share information about ongoing projects. The introduction of a unified solution like Google Workspace alters all that by centralizing all data flows in one place.

With Google Workspace from Google service provider, users with a wide variety of services, all accessible through a single login, including email, chat, the use of rooms and breakout spaces, documents, video calling, shared calendars, and more. In 2023, more and more businesses will see the benefits of using umbrella technologies to centralize and streamline company-wide communication. 

2. Improving collaboration

How much effort do you invest in logistics like scheduling meetings and coordinating availability across time zones and team members? With the help of apps like Google Workspace, workers now have more leeway to adapt to changing circumstances and make decisions more quickly. One example is the use of shared calendars, which allow you to know when others are free and organize meetings with instantaneous email invitations.

In addition, team members may effortlessly collaborate on documents, spreadsheets, and slides on their own devices, even when they don’t have access to the internet. In addition, the real-time saving of all revisions makes it simple for multiple people (both inside and outside the firm) to work together on a single project while chatting, asking questions, and keeping tabs on the progress of the job. The arrival of Google Cloud, which renders file-sharing over email superfluous, is another significant step in this direction, helping to ease bottlenecks and storage space limits along the way.

4. Better Data Analytics

In our fast-paced world, dashboards are a godsend, making it possible for stakeholders to monitor app usage and access controls with a quick glimpse through the Google Admin Console. Are you interested in monitoring IP addresses or the movement of confidential information inside your industry out of concerns around misuse, lack of security, or lack of permission-based access? With the help of dashboards, managers can keep tabs on data in real-time, limit access to sensitive information, and protect the system from potential threats.
